В чем основное различие между гейтами и промежуточным ПО в laravel?
люди, я просто хочу задать очень четкий вопрос. я знаю, что промежуточное программное обеспечение используется для аутентификации пользователя, но ворота и политика ограничивают поведение пользователя в зависимости от его/ее роли. Я использовал шлюзы LARAVEL для перенаправления пользователя на страницу входа, если он не аутентифицирован. Итак, вопрос: содержит ли промежуточное ПО LARAVEL гейты или что?? Спасибо, продвинутый.
1 ответ
Ворота
Шлюзы в основном используются для проверки того, что пользователь авторизован для выполнения данного действия.
ПО промежуточного слоя
Промежуточное ПО предоставляет способ проверки и фильтрации HTTP-запросов, поступающих в ваше приложение. Например: Laravel включает промежуточное ПО, которое проверяет, что пользователь вашего приложения аутентифицирован. и вы можете определить свое собственное промежуточное ПО.